Fairmont opens its first hotel in the Philippines

Fairmont Hotels & Resorts has opened Fairmont Makati hotel, marking the brand’s entry into the Philippines.

The property is located in the same tower as Raffles Makati, a 32-room, all-suite hotel, and Raffles Residences, featuring 237 one- to four-bedroom residences, both operated under parent company Fairmont Raffles Hotels International.

Situated in Makati city, in the centre of Manila’s central business district, Fairmont Makati hotel features seven F&B outlets including Spectrum all-day dining; Café Macaron; Lounge at Fairmont serving afternoon tea and Longs Bar, inspired by the renowned bar of the same name at Raffles Singapore Hotel.

Up to 1700 square meters (18,000 square feet) of function space including a 900 square metre ballroom, and a 1200 square meters (14,000 square feet) Willow Stream Spa, will be available.

The hotel joins the Fairmont’s growing portfolio of hotel’s within the Asia Pacific region, including the recently-opened Fairmont Jaipur in India and Shanghai’s Fairmont Peace Hotel.
